    Are these 30 round carbine mags legit?

    Greetings everyone,

    After reading the CMPicon article on them, visiting the James Wesley website and reading a thread on this website, there is a LOT to keep straight regarding 30 round carbine mags. I have an opportunity to buy some but they are expensive and I'm concerned they are junk. I have a Korean 30rd mag that isn't the smoothest but seems to work OK and a ProMag that I really like. That said, I wouldn't mind having a couple of the real McCoys.

    Based upon what I've read, the marking being deep and clear is suspect as well as the bolster being square. I'm hoping the folks on this forum can take a look at the pictures and tell me what they think.

    I don't think those are Tony's magazines. Notice how rounded the back of the magazine is around the M2. I had one of his, and the back was flat and corners crisp like USGI, The rounded back is a good indication of junk.
